Hi
1, I suggest you read the following: https://www.scambook.com/company/view/98638/Canadian-Visa-Expert and http://tinyurl.com/ycpxj89u 2. Then make up your mind. Most people don't require visa companies to complete an Express Entry application for Canada, and to submit an Expression of Interest on the Official website is free. You can also check on https://www.canada.ca/en/services/immigration-citizenship.html if you actually qualify with sufficient points. |
